The night passed without incident.

At 5 a.m. the next morning, Hajime Hoshita woke up on time.

Since there were no missions assigned, he washed up and left the Root base. Finding a secluded grove, he began his daily physical training.

After an hour of conditioning, he transitioned into chakra control training.

Half an hour later, Hajime paused, frowning slightly. "At sixteen, for the original me, my potential has more or less reached its limit."

"From here on out, it's all about accumulating experience and steady refinement. A standard jōnin would be the upper ceiling. As for elite jōnin or Kage-level, there'd be no point even dreaming about it."

Geniuses typically show signs of greatness in their early teens.

Especially those with the potential to become Kage.

People like Minato Namikaze, Kakashi Hatake, Shisui Uchiha, and Itachi Uchiha were all examples of this.

At Hajime's age, if one still hadn't reached jōnin-level strength, it usually meant their potential was already nearly exhausted.

However, with the awakening of his past life memories and the addition of Hashirama's cells, there was no telling how much his ceiling could be raised.

Especially in the terms of ninjutsu.

"If my talent in ninjutsu, taijutsu, and genjutsu hasn't seen a significant boost, that could be problematic. I might be stuck walking the brute-force path from here on."

After resting briefly, Hajime stood and made his way toward the center of Konoha.

He needed to buy balloons and rubber balls to begin training the Rasengan.

Although this technique didn't really suit his current combat style, practicing this A-rank ninjutsu without hand seals could help him evaluate something important.

For example, whether his awakened past life memories had improved his talent in ninjutsu.

If not, then mastering Wood Release might not even be possible.

After purchasing the balloons and balls, and grabbing breakfast along the way, Hajime returned to the Root base and began his Rasengan training.

The first step: inject chakra into the water balloon and rotate it until it bursts.

In principle, Hajime had his own understanding.

Injecting chakra into the water balloon and rotating it also involved a crucial step—chakra compression.

If the chakra was compressed to a sufficient intensity and rotated, it would create a terrifying, spiraling force that tore outward.

Of course, understanding the theory and actually executing it were two different things.

An hour later, Hajime paused his training, inwardly sighing in admiration, "Naruto might be a blockhead, but his innate talent isn't low at all!"

After carefully storing away the water balloons, Hajime stepped outside and headed to Training Ground 9, located right next to the Root base.

Danzō hadn't arrived yet, so Hajime decided to try out his Wind Release ninjutsu.

Wind Release: Breakthrough!

He clapped his hands together, then swiftly formed three hand seals.

Dog → Horse → Bird !

With the final seal, Hajime inhaled deeply and then exhaled.

With a loud boom, a violent gust of wind burst forth, sweeping across the area ahead.

"Roughly three seals in one second. Still a bit slow."

Somewhat dissatisfied, Hajime took out a shuriken, brought it to his lips, and blew on it. Wind Release chakra clung to it, making the shuriken spin at high speed.

With a flick of his arm, the shuriken shot out like a spinning windmill, slicing cleanly through three large trees before finally exhausting its Wind chakra and embedding itself in the trunk of a fourth tree.

"Not bad in terms of power… Paired with skilled shurikenjutsu, the threat to an opponent would increase drastically."

Hajime was quite pleased with this Wind-infused shuriken technique. It didn't require hand seals, making its activation speed much faster.

Next—

He drew the ninja blade strapped to his back.

Buzz!

As Wind Release chakra was infused into the blade, its sharpness increased dramatically.

Wind Release: Vacuum Blade!

This was the only B-rank jutsu Hajime had mastered—a jutsu at jōnin difficulty level.

But in truth, he hadn't fully grasped it yet.

He could only apply it to his ninja sword to enhance its cutting power.

The ultimate form of this B-rank jutsu was seen when Danzō fought Sasuke Uchiha—by infusing chakra into a kunai, the chakra would take solid form, turning it into a razor-sharp blade.

Unfortunately, Hajime's chakra control had previously been insufficient, and his training in Wind Release nature transformation had been lacking, preventing him from fully completing this jutsu.

Still, even a partial mastery combined with solid swordsmanship had once made Hajime an elite among chūnin.

Of course, a jutsu's rank didn't directly reflect its power—only the difficulty of learning it.

That said, jutsu with high learning difficulty typically came with high requirements—like chakra volume, chakra control, form manipulation, and nature transformation.

So in practice, jutsu that are harder to learn usually don't have a low baseline of power.

The true factors that determine a jutsu's power are: chakra volume, form manipulation, and nature transformation.

"`Breakthrough` doesn't have much offensive power. It's more of a support-type jutsu."

"The shuriken enhancement tests your throwing skill. But for me, the most important technique is this B-rank Vacuum Blade."

Sheathing his sword, Hajime thought to himself, "Still, I have some talent in kenjutsu. For developing the Vacuum Blade, I don't necessarily need to follow Danzō's method. Instead, I could take a path like Konoha's White Fang—high-speed, high-impact strikes."

"In that case, I'll need sharper Wind Release nature transformation… or perhaps combine it with form manipulation to raise the overall power."

Asuma Sarutobi's method of training Wind Release focused on making it thinner and sharper.

Hajime contemplated, "So besides continuing to refine the nature transformation… what direction can I take with the form manipulation?"

"Cutting… flowing Wind Release chakra that's thinner, sharper…"

"Form manipulation… sawtooth-shaped?"

As he was deep in thought, the sound of footsteps snapped him to attention. Hajime quickly turned and bowed respectfully.

"Lord Danzō!"

Danzō gave a slight nod, then spoke calmly, "We will now begin your Wood Release training."

"The first technique I will teach you is Wood Locking Wall. It uses only three hand seals."

"Rat → Dog → Tiger!"

Hajime nodded quickly, then raised his hands and slowly began forming the seals.

Danzō continued, "Wood Release, a kekkei genkai, is a new nature transformation created by combining Earth and Water Release."

"When forming the seals, you must simultaneously perform both nature transformations and merge them to create Wood Release."

With that, Danzō fell silent and simply watched.

Hajime, inwardly: That's it?

Struggling to keep his expression composed, Hajime quickly responded, "Understood, Lord Danzō! I'll give it my all!"

He restarted the hand seals.

Earlier, he hadn't used any chakra.

This time, he extracted chakra—specifically Earth and Water Release chakra.

Thanks to the Hashirama cells in his body, the process happened naturally with the seals, as though it were instinctive, without the need for specialized training.

Two distinct chakra natures were drawn from his cells, entered his chakra network, and under the guidance of the hand seals, fused naturally—creating a new chakra nature:

Wood Release!

A surge of joy bubbled inside Hajime.

This process had been far easier than expected.

He quickly directed the chakra from the soles of his feet into the ground.

Wood Release: Wood Locking Wall!

In the next moment, the ground cracked open, and thick, square logs of wood burst upward, forming a wooden barrier three feet in front of Hajime.

It worked!

Though his expression remained calm, a hint of joy surfaced in Danzō's eyes.

Konoha finally had a new Wood Release user!

And this one… belonged to him, Shimura Danzō!
